    def getRemoteBug(self, bug_id):
        """See `ExternalBugTracker`."""
        # Only parse tables to save time and memory. If we didn't have
        # to check for application errors in the page (using
        # _checkForApplicationError) then we could be much more
        # specific than this.
        bug_page = BeautifulSoup(self._getPage('view.php?id=%s' %
                                               bug_id).content,
                                 convertEntities=BeautifulSoup.HTML_ENTITIES,
                                 parseOnlyThese=SoupStrainer('table'))

        app_error = self._checkForApplicationError(bug_page)
        if app_error:
            app_error_code, app_error_message = app_error
            # 1100 is ERROR_BUG_NOT_FOUND in Mantis (see
            # mantisbt/core/constant_inc.php).
            if app_error_code == '1100':
                return None, None
            else:
                raise BugWatchUpdateError("Mantis APPLICATION ERROR #%s: %s" %
                                          (app_error_code, app_error_message))

        bug = {
            'id': bug_id,
            'status': self._findValueRightOfKey(bug_page, 'Status'),
            'resolution': self._findValueRightOfKey(bug_page, 'Resolution')
        }

        return int(bug_id), bug

def get_feedback_messages(content):
    """Find and return the feedback messages of the page."""
    message_classes = [
        'message', 'informational message', 'error message', 'warning message'
    ]
    soup = BeautifulSoup(content,
                         parseOnlyThese=SoupStrainer(
                             ['div', 'p'], {'class': message_classes}))
    return [extract_text(tag) for tag in soup]

def find_tags_by_class(content, class_, only_first=False):
    """Find and return one or more tags matching the given class(es)"""

    match_classes = set(class_.split())

    def class_matcher(value):
        if value is None:
            return False
        classes = set(value.split())
        return match_classes.issubset(classes)

    soup = BeautifulSoup(
        content, parseOnlyThese=SoupStrainer(attrs={'class': class_matcher}))
    if only_first:
        find = BeautifulSoup.find
    else:
        find = BeautifulSoup.findAll
    return find(soup, attrs={'class': class_matcher})

def find_tag_by_id(content, id):
    """Find and return the tag with the given ID"""
    if isinstance(content, PageElement):
        elements_with_id = content.findAll(True, {'id': id})
    elif isinstance(content, PageElement4):
        elements_with_id = content.find_all(True, {'id': id})
    else:
        elements_with_id = [
            tag for tag in BeautifulSoup(content,
                                         parseOnlyThese=SoupStrainer(id=id))
        ]
    if len(elements_with_id) == 0:
        return None
    elif len(elements_with_id) == 1:
        return elements_with_id[0]
    else:
        raise DuplicateIdError('Found %d elements with id %r' %
                               (len(elements_with_id), id))
